I have an 87 chevy V20 with the 350 and swapped my TH400 for a 4l80E and used the E-Z TCU transmission controller and it worked fine for a small while and now I can start it and it works fine and then after a short time of use it goes into limp mode and wont come out till I turn it off. I have gone through the entire wiring harness and all the wires are good and I even took the pan off the transmission and checked everything in there. I changed the speed sensors and that seemed to fix it for a short time but I am at a complete loss so any help would be appreciated.
